Why doesn't Darth Vader remember C-3PO?

Darth Vader acts like he doesn't even know C-3PO or R2D2. They were with him since he was a child. He did everything he could to forget his past. Also, his plating had been replaced many times, and protocol droids all look very similar.

Why did Obi-Wan not recognise C3P0?

The real reason why Obi-Wan Kenobi, the Lars family, or Darth Vader didn't act in the original Star Wars trilogy as though they knew C-3PO or R2-D2 previously is that the prequel trilogy, in which they first meet the two droids, had not been written yet.

Why doesn t Owen remember 3PO?

The lack of recognition could have come from an old man simply not remembering the passing droids of his youth. Lastly, Owen didn't seem the sentimental type to form any emotional attachments to droids. Being a practical man, he viewed them as tools to be used and replaced when they no longer functioned.

Why did they not wipe R2-D2 memory?

During the Clone Wars, it was common practice to wipe the minds of astromech droids after every mission to avoid the risk of Separatists taking valued information. But Anakin remained staunchly against this idea for R2-D2, meaning the droid never had to worry about losing the memories of his past.

Did Darth Vader ever see C-3PO?

in the Dark Horse comic series star Wars Tales, which is now part of legends, it's revealed that Darth Vader did recognize C. 3PO on Cloud City. when 3PO was shot by Stormtroopers, his parts were brought before Vader.

Why did Bail Organa wipe C-3PO's memory?

Shortly after the Galactic Empire was formed, Bail Organa, in order to protect Princess Leia, had C-3PO's memory wiped clean in order for the droid to not spill any confidential information, especially information related to Leia's true lineage, which would make her a target of the Emperor.
